#ifndef ___VBox_VBoxGuest2_h
#define ___VBox_VBoxGuest2_h
#include <iprt/assert.h>
#ifdef VBOX_WITH_HGCM
# include <VBox/VMMDev2.h>
/**
* HGCM connect info structure.
*
* This is used by VBOXGUEST_IOCTL_HGCM_CONNECT and in VbglR0.
*
* @ingroup grp_vboxguest
*/
# pragma pack(1) /* explicit packing for good measure. */
typedef struct VBoxGuestHGCMConnectInfo
{
int32_t result; /**< OUT */
HGCMServiceLocation Loc; /**< IN */
uint32_t u32ClientID; /**< OUT */
} VBoxGuestHGCMConnectInfo;
AssertCompileSize(VBoxGuestHGCMConnectInfo, 4+4+128+4);
# pragma pack()
/**
* HGCM connect info structure.
*
* This is used by VBOXGUEST_IOCTL_HGCM_DISCONNECT and in VbglR0.
*
* @ingroup grp_vboxguest
*/
typedef struct VBoxGuestHGCMDisconnectInfo
{
int32_t result; /**< OUT */
uint32_t u32ClientID; /**< IN */
} VBoxGuestHGCMDisconnectInfo;
AssertCompileSize(VBoxGuestHGCMDisconnectInfo, 8);
/**
* HGCM call info structure.
*
* This is used by VBOXGUEST_IOCTL_HGCM_CALL.
*
* @ingroup grp_vboxguest
*/
typedef struct VBoxGuestHGCMCallInfo
{
int32_t result; /**< OUT Host HGCM return code.*/
uint32_t u32ClientID; /**< IN The id of the caller. */
uint32_t u32Function; /**< IN Function number. */
uint32_t cParms; /**< IN How many parms. */
/* Parameters follow in form HGCMFunctionParameter aParms[cParms] */
} VBoxGuestHGCMCallInfo;
AssertCompileSize(VBoxGuestHGCMCallInfo, 16);
/**
* HGCM call info structure.
*
* This is used by VBOXGUEST_IOCTL_HGCM_CALL_TIMED.
*
* @ingroup grp_vboxguest
*/
# pragma pack(1) /* explicit packing for good measure. */
typedef struct VBoxGuestHGCMCallInfoTimed
{
uint32_t u32Timeout; /**< IN How long to wait for completion before cancelling the call. */
uint32_t fInterruptible; /**< IN Is this request interruptible? */
VBoxGuestHGCMCallInfo info; /**< IN/OUT The rest of the call information. Placed after the timeout
* so that the parameters follow as they would for a normal call. */
/* Parameters follow in form HGCMFunctionParameter aParms[cParms] */
} VBoxGuestHGCMCallInfoTimed;
AssertCompileSize(VBoxGuestHGCMCallInfoTimed, 8+16);
# pragma pack()
#endif /* VBOX_WITH_HGCM */
#endif
